Fixed-Time Adaptive Fuzzy Control for Uncertain Multi-agent Systems with Deferred Dynamic Constraints via Dynamic-Memory Event-Triggered Mechanism

摘要

This study addresses the adaptive fuzzy fixed-time control problem for a class of non-strict feedback multi-agent systems (MAS) based on dynamic-memory event-triggered mechanism (DMETM). Based on the fixed-time adaptive fuzzy control strategy, we introduce a prescribed-time scaling function and a barrier function to make the tracking error converge to a dynamically defined boundary within a specified time. Furthermore, we consider the influence of historical information of internal dynamic variables on trigger conditions in DMETM, which more effectively reduces the consumption of system resources. Utilizing the proposed controller, it can be demonstrated that all followers track the specific trajectory established by the leader within fixed time, and the error boundary constraint of the MAS is achieved. Simulation results confirm the efficacy and superiority of this control strategy.
